Fotografický magazín "iZIN IDIF" každý týden ve Vašem e-mailu.
Co nového ve světě fotografie!
Zadejte Vaši e-mailovou adresu:
Kamarád fotí rád?
Přihlas ho k odběru fotomagazínu!
Zadejte e-mailovou adresu kamaráda:
![OBLIBENE_TITLE2](/templates/107/gr/print-logo.gif)
Začínáme s
Krok za krokem - Změna uživatelského jména v Mac OS X
5. ledna 2005, 00.00 | V Mac OS X je triviální vytvořit nového uživatele, ale změnit jméno (tzv. short name) již vytvořeného uživatelského účtu tak jednoduché není. Na dnešním příkladu si ukážeme přesný postup, jak takové uživatelské jméno změnit. Budeme k tomu potřebovat Mac OS X a nástroje, které se nachází v systému - Terminal a Netinfo Manager.
V Mac OS X je triviální vytvořit nového uživatele, ale změnit jméno (tzv. short name) již vytvořeného uživatelského účtu tak jednoduché není. Na dnešním příkladu si ukážeme přesný postup, jak takové uživatelské jméno změnit. Budeme k tomu potřebovat Mac OS X a nástroje, které se nachází v systému - Terminal a Netinfo Manager.Začínáme
Jestliže chcete změnit jméno účtu - v našem případě budeme měnit uživatelské jméno "extrémně dlouhé jméno" na "krátké jméno" - budete v první řadě potřebovat druhý uživatelský účet s administrátorskými právy na vašem počítači. Pokud již takový účet máte, stačí se do něj zalogovat, pokud nikoliv, musíte jej v Předvolbách systému vytvořit. Zvolte položku Accounts a ve spodní části klikněte na tlačítko + (plus). Dojde k vytvoření nového účtu - zvolte jméno a heslo a v panelu Security (Bezpečnost) nezapomeňte zaškrtnout "Allow User To Administer This Computer". Tím jsme vytvořili nový administrátorský účet. Nyní se odlogujte a přihlašte se do nového administrátorského účtu, který jsme právě vytvořili.
![](/old-idif/images/zmenajmena_1.jpg)
NetInfo Manager
Po zalogovaní jako administrátor spusťte program NetInfo Manager (Applications/Utilities) a zvolte složku Users a jméno účtu, který chcete přejmenovat (Extrémně dlouhé jméno). Klikněte na ikonku zámečku v levém dolním rohu a autorizujte se. Nyní můžete dolní část, kde se nacházejí jednotlivé atributy, modifikovat. Než tak začnete činit, musím vás upozornit, že NetInfo Manager je velmi mocný nástroj a je potřeba postupovat přesně podle návodu a nic jiného neměnit! Není od věci před celou operací systém zazálohovat.
![](/old-idif/images/zmenajmena_2.jpg)
V listu atributů najděte položku Realname a změňte její hodnotu na nové jméno (v našem případě 'krátké jméno'). Tím jsme změnili jméno účtu, respektive dlouhé jméno, ale to můžeme konec konců změnit i přímo v Předvolbách systému. Důležitější je změnit tzv. shortname a název domovské složky. Nyní zkontrolujte všechny položky a jejich hodnoty - všude, kde se nachází staré shortname změňte hodnotu na nové shortname. Čili v našem případě dojde ke změně extremnedlouhojmeno -> kratkejmeno. Shortname je vždy jedno slovo a pro systém (a unix) je důležitější než dlouhé jméno - Realname. Jméno musíte změnit i v položce home, kde je uvedená cesta k domovské složce. Po přepsání všech hodnot, které obsahují staré shortname, stiskněte klávesovou zkratku Jablíčko - S a v následujícím dialogu potvrďte zápis změn (Update This Copy).
![](/old-idif/images/zmenajmena_3.jpg)
Ale tím s NetInfem ještě nekončíme. Každý uživatel automaticky patří do skupiny, která má stejné jméno. Proto se v NetInfo Manageru vraťte o úroveň výše a zvolte složku Groups a v ní skupinu se starým uživatelským jménem. Hodnotu u položky Name změňte na název nové skupiny - totožné se shortname, v našem případě tedy 'kratkejmeno'. Opět uložte změny (Jablíčko - S) a potvrďte dialog (Update This Copy).
![](/old-idif/images/zmenajmena_4.jpg)
Přejmenování domovské složky
V NetInfo Manageru jsme provedli změnu uživatelského jména a pokud jste postupovali přesně podle výše uvedených instrukcí, vše by mělo být připraveno. Nyní je ještě nutné změnit název domovské složky a k tomu budeme potřebovat Terminal. Po spuštění (nachází se v Applications/Utilities) napište:
stiskněte Return a následně:
cd /Users
a Return. Vypíše se vám seznam všech uživatelských složek a jedna z nich bude mít i název starého účtu. To musíme změnit, a proto napište:
ls
konkrétně v našem případě:
sudo mv STARE-JMENO NOVÉ-JMENO
a stiskněte Return. Budete požádáni o heslo, které zadejte a stiskněte opět Return. To je vše! Jméno účtu jsme kompletně změnili a nyní se do něj můžete zalogovat. Tento postup byl popsán přímo pro Panthera, pro Jaguára je totožný, ale na závěr je nutné provést ještě jednu změnu.
sudo mv extremnedlouhejmeno kratkejmeno
![](/old-idif/images/zmenajmena_5.jpg)
Jaguar - přejmenování Klíčenky
V Jaguaru byla Klíčenka (Keychain) pojmenována stejně jako byl název účtu - tudíž je nutné ji také přejmenovat. Z toho důvodu Terminal ještě nezavírejte a napište:
konkrétně:
cd NOVE_UZIVATELSKE-JMENO
a stiskněte Return a napište:
cd kratkejmeno
konkrétně v našem případě:
sudo mv Library/Keychains/STARE-JMENO Library/Keychains/NOVE-JMENO
a stisknete Return. A nyní změnu názvu jména udělali i uživatelé Mac OS X 10.2.
sudo mv Library/Keychains/extremnedlouhejmeno Library/Keychains/kratkejmeno
![](/old-idif/images/zmenajmena_6.jpg)
Jak vidíte, změna jména účtu není zcela jednoduchá, ale pomocí tohoto návodu vám příliš času nezabere. Pro operační systém je výchozí shortname, které není možné modifikovat přímo v Předvolbách systému, ale až v NetInfo Manageru. Pokud si na celý postup netroufáte, můžete zkusit ještě jinou cestu - obsah celé své domovské složky zkopírujte na externí disk, vytvořte nový účet s požadovaným jménem, zalogujte se do něj a z externího disku data nakopírujte zpět a restartujte. Ideální je použít externí disk nebo jiný logický oddíl, aby nedošlo k problémům s právy.